Visited on a Monday for their set meal deal (circa £17). 3 courses and one shared side. Excellent value for money, and had enough to take home for lunch the next day. Food Delicious - freshly prepared and plentiful. Be prepared to relax however as they serve each course seperatly and everything seems to be made from scratch. I would allow a couple of hours for your meal. Service Friendly and attentive. The owner is particularly friendly. Atmosphere Laid back - family vibe. 9/10 would recommend

I contacted So India about a large order to be delivered nearby in advance for a hen do. They were keen to sort it for us and were really easy to communicate with by email. Because we ordered 20+ main dishes they kindly gave us poppadoms and a few side dishes for free, as well as a bottle of Prosecco for the bride to be which was really sweet and appreciated. They made contact with me the week of the event, and it was easy for them to do payment over the phone. They answered a last-minute query about an allergy really promptly. The large order was completely correct on delivery and the food tasted delicious! Everyone really enjoyed it.

Update 03/09/2023 The restraunt is now named "India Raj" and the menu has changed. No ostrich tikka or garlic mussels on the new menu. The owner and staff are the same and the menu appears a little less adventurous. August 2022. It's difficult to find unique Indian cuisine, but Ostrich Tikka caught my eye and I was sold. Unfortunately ostrich was off the menu that night so I settled for an Achari Gosht, it was ok but unexciting. My wife's "Honey roasted spicy lamb" and her mother's "Chicken Hariyaly" were exceptional and provided the "taste sensation" that I was looking for. Another interesting find were the Garlic Mussels, it was a dish that I wouldn't normally chance at an Indian restaurant and didn't. My wife on the other hand took the risk and was well rewarded. The thick garlicky sauce was divine and made my Tiger Prawn Puree seem bland in comparison. The service was good, the waiters were attentive, friendly and chatty. Altogether an excellent evening.
